It is a special case of denial of service (DoS) attack in wireless mesh networks (WMNs) known as selective forwarding attack .The CAD algorithm is based on two strategies. With such an attack, a misbehaving mesh router just forwards a subset of packets it receives but drops the others. Channel estimation is the procedure to estimate the normal loss rate due to bad channel quality or medium access collision. Traffic monitoring is to monitor the actual loss rate, if the monitored loss rate at certain hops exceeds the estimated loss rate, those nodes involved will be identified as attackers. To determine the optimal detection thresholds that minimizes the summation of false alarm and missed detection probabilities. In this work the system is free from collision or jamming attacks, when an attacker introduces noise to simulate a noisy channel, it indeed affects the sensing process which in turn leads to inaccurate threshold.
